diff options
| author | Zak Greant <zak@php.net> | 2002-03-24 23:33:07 +0000 | 
|---|---|---|
| committer | Zak Greant <zak@php.net> | 2002-03-24 23:33:07 +0000 | 
| commit | 3fae05b0143e5b6180aff14f44b66a42220864b9 (patch) | |
| tree | 80690bc24d6f7f7878b91f09e4780c7a07308cf9 /ext/mysql/php_mysql.c | |
| parent | 26e1958c8e48be30cc731a78f3e22747498e3b19 (diff) | |
| download | php-git-3fae05b0143e5b6180aff14f44b66a42220864b9.tar.gz | |
Added mysql_table_name() alias for mysql_tablename()
Improved logic of parameter parsing code for mysql_ping
 - made test for no arguments more explicit
 - combined to if blocks into one if/else if block
Diffstat (limited to 'ext/mysql/php_mysql.c')
| -rw-r--r-- | ext/mysql/php_mysql.c | 9 | 
1 files changed, 4 insertions, 5 deletions
| diff --git a/ext/mysql/php_mysql.c b/ext/mysql/php_mysql.c index f4c5f56822..1abce1947a 100644 --- a/ext/mysql/php_mysql.c +++ b/ext/mysql/php_mysql.c @@ -188,6 +188,7 @@ function_entry mysql_functions[] = {  	PHP_FALIAS(mysql_db_name,		mysql_result,		NULL)  	PHP_FALIAS(mysql_dbname,		mysql_result,		NULL)  	PHP_FALIAS(mysql_tablename,		mysql_result,		NULL) +	PHP_FALIAS(mysql_table_name,	mysql_result,		NULL)  	{NULL, NULL, NULL}  };  /* }}} */ @@ -2246,13 +2247,11 @@ PHP_FUNCTION(mysql_ping)  	int             id         = -1;  	php_mysql_conn *mysql; -	if (zend_parse_parameters(ZEND_NUM_ARGS() TSRMLS_CC, "|r", &mysql_link)==FAILURE) { -		return; -	} -	 -	if (! ZEND_NUM_ARGS()) { +	if (0 == ZEND_NUM_ARGS()) {  		id = php_mysql_get_default_link(INTERNAL_FUNCTION_PARAM_PASSTHRU);  		CHECK_LINK(id); +	} else if (zend_parse_parameters(ZEND_NUM_ARGS() TSRMLS_CC, "r", &mysql_link)==FAILURE) { +		return;  	}  	ZEND_FETCH_RESOURCE2(mysql, php_mysql_conn *, &mysql_link, id, "MySQL-Link", le_link, le_plink); | 
